Commit Graph

  • f0a49de85b
    Merge pull request #8275 from spesmilo/qt_vkbd ThomasV 2023-03-23 13:33:36 +0100
  • 8e7cbd6ca2 qml: let user enter lnurl6 amount ThomasV 2023-03-23 12:43:43 +0100
  • 39097783c3 qml: ask password to show seed ThomasV 2023-03-23 11:04:58 +0100
  • abae815777 qml: TxDetails small form-factor fix, wrap buttons to below fee-bump text if width is constrained Sander van Grieken 2023-03-23 10:56:42 +0100
  • f89e0b80e6 qml: wizard add label for second password entry Sander van Grieken 2023-03-23 10:46:28 +0100
  • 75e5e4afd8 android: set default localization to en_GB to force number formatting and parsing to en_GB Sander van Grieken 2023-03-22 13:56:14 +0100
  • 4bdd521a4b qml: abstract ElDialog resize behavior to property Sander van Grieken 2023-03-22 13:56:03 +0100
  • 17bb1ad5c5 qml: enable Qt virtual keyboard and add Electrum keyboard style, modified from Qt 'default' style Sander van Grieken 2023-03-21 10:40:28 +0100
  • e7cc2c5a63 Revert "qml: pressing "Esc" on desktop to ~simulate "back" button" Sander van Grieken 2023-03-23 10:12:05 +0100
  • 9eb25cd442 follow-up a080e5130f ThomasV 2023-03-23 08:22:36 +0100
  • 7834f6c427
    commands: fix satoshis decimal conversion in payto cmd and others SomberNight 2023-03-22 12:22:36 +0000
  • 0d007b5739 follow-up aa3697d ThomasV 2023-03-22 10:21:09 +0100
  • 36687e436d
    Merge pull request #8273 from SomberNight/202303_qml_esc_shortcut ThomasV 2023-03-22 08:15:01 +0100
  • 27bc0bb552
    Merge pull request #8267 from SomberNight/202303_build_userid1000 ghost43 2023-03-21 17:54:29 +0000
  • 558eb1a372
    qml: reorganise toolbarTopLayout, so that top-left click opens menu SomberNight 2023-03-21 17:51:29 +0000
  • 7f7ee8d82f
    qml: pressing "Esc" on desktop to ~simulate "back" button SomberNight 2023-03-21 16:51:50 +0000
  • 98304662ca
    android build: default to log_level=2 SomberNight 2023-03-21 16:34:39 +0000
  • bac889c593 android: fix ply depends assert Sander van Grieken 2023-03-21 14:32:36 +0100
  • 3fb3e3b809 lnurl6: pay invoice directly ThomasV 2023-03-21 17:08:36 +0100
  • ed0f1ea27f
    qt receive_tab: use correct qrcode icon (based on dark/light theme) SomberNight 2023-03-21 15:31:07 +0000
  • 6b9d294a86 android: log_level 2 when running in CI Sander van Grieken 2023-03-21 14:13:00 +0100
  • 1176552132 android: upgrade to Qt 5.15.7, PyQt5 5.15.9 Sander van Grieken 2023-03-21 12:41:20 +0100
  • 1503ef1e2a follow-up previous commit ThomasV 2023-03-21 10:41:54 +0100
  • a080e5130f Qt receive_tab: toggle_view_button instead of tabs ThomasV 2023-03-21 08:42:30 +0100
  • 3cf732cb51 qml: introduction text bottom margins in RbF bump fee and cancel dialogs Sander van Grieken 2023-03-21 09:44:53 +0100
  • 077ea9a4a5 qml: AddressDetails heading Sander van Grieken 2023-03-21 09:44:40 +0100
  • ce6e4d99e7 Qt history_list: disable summary if fx history is not available ThomasV 2023-03-21 08:04:03 +0100
  • c9b6a6c01e
    build: fix repro builds where host userid != 1000 SomberNight 2023-03-20 02:02:14 +0000
  • 9df5f55a1f
    password unification: bugfix, now passes test cases SomberNight 2023-03-20 20:00:28 +0000
  • 11f06d860e
    tests: add more tests for daemon.update_password_for_directory SomberNight 2023-03-20 19:54:53 +0000
  • aac9afa7c1
    tests: add a failing testcase for daemon.update_password_for_directory SomberNight 2023-03-20 17:49:50 +0000
  • a5c58f8aae qml: layout fixes for small form-factor devices Sander van Grieken 2023-03-20 19:52:01 +0100
  • 677e1259df qml: ElDialog now defaults to parent on Overlay.overlay This was replicated in basically all ElDialog derived dialogs Sander van Grieken 2023-03-20 16:52:21 +0100
  • b8d4ccd432
    wallet: fix get_locktime_for_new_transaction for lagging server SomberNight 2023-03-20 15:50:38 +0000
  • 4ed69cc54f qml: BtcField/FiatField ImhDigitsOnly input method hint Sander van Grieken 2023-03-20 14:10:13 +0100
  • c9df290301 android: update P4A to 8589243afb48fdb116d791dc5b3973382e83273f include Qt Virtual Keyboard libraries and associated QtQuick components Sander van Grieken 2023-03-20 13:15:03 +0100
  • 4fa192d9e7 follow-up c3e52bfafc ThomasV 2023-03-20 11:09:18 +0100
  • 2e797b4d77 Merge branch 'master' of github.com:spesmilo/electrum ThomasV 2023-03-20 11:00:30 +0100
  • 5ee89a294e
    Merge pull request #8266 from SomberNight/202303_cb_uint16 ThomasV 2023-03-20 07:49:52 +0100
  • 6e472efd5f
    build: follow-up prev: only use host userid for local dev builds SomberNight 2023-03-20 01:47:41 +0000
  • ab073827cf
    build: use uid of user building the build containers Sander van Grieken 2023-03-19 14:29:29 +0100
  • 08ae0a73b2
    build: add separate .dockerignore files SomberNight 2023-03-20 01:33:04 +0000
  • 5a4c39cb94
    lnutil.ImportedChannelBackupStorage: change ser format: int16->uint16 SomberNight 2023-03-19 19:32:09 +0000
  • 4fb35c0002
    lnutil: clean-up ImportedChannelBackupStorage.from_bytes SomberNight 2023-03-19 19:22:41 +0000
  • a30cda4ebd
    lnutil: test ImportedChannelBackupStorage.from_bytes SomberNight 2023-03-19 19:15:44 +0000
  • 68bba47052
    commands: small fix and clean-up for "serialize" cmd SomberNight 2023-03-19 18:34:43 +0000
  • 5cf4b346a9 change message: detached QR code window ThomasV 2023-03-19 11:40:52 +0100
  • 8b0a6940bc receive tab: disable widgets if request has expired, instead of applying red stylesheet ThomasV 2023-03-19 11:13:45 +0100
  • 4243b250b1 qt send_tab: simplify method names. ThomasV 2023-03-19 10:44:33 +0100
  • b07fe970bf receive tab: do not use ButtonsTextEdit, add toggle to toolbar. ThomasV 2023-03-17 18:55:37 +0100
  • c3e52bfafc Qt: allow to save invoices that have no amount (such invoices are already saved by the QML GUI.) ThomasV 2023-03-19 09:39:04 +0100
  • 5ab3a250c5 qml: remove '1 month' expiry option. ThomasV 2023-03-19 09:00:51 +0100
  • aa3697de74 Qr request_list: maybe fix elusive segfault ThomasV 2023-03-19 06:36:36 +0100
  • 5c60b9ad29 ln invoice dialog: show fallback address ThomasV 2022-08-09 17:50:41 +0200
  • 3b78466123 simplify code (follow-up 2836dccfbb) ThomasV 2023-03-18 17:44:48 +0100
  • d7c5c40c1d Save user-entered amount in invoice. fixes #8252. ThomasV 2023-03-18 16:46:20 +0100
  • dd2dced296 follow-up 2836dccfbb ThomasV 2023-03-18 13:14:14 +0100
  • 2836dccfbb qml: Handle situation where no more addresses are available without creating addresses beyond the gap limit. ThomasV 2023-03-18 10:56:25 +0100
  • cb4c99dc19 qml: styling CloseChannelDialog error text Sander van Grieken 2023-03-18 11:25:57 +0100
  • 8cc610298b QML: auto-delete expired requests. Add action to Qt menu ThomasV 2023-03-18 09:59:18 +0100
  • d8abab34d8
    build: rm "non-free" from debian apt sources lists SomberNight 2023-03-18 04:15:09 +0000
  • f6699e01c3 qml: minor text change ThomasV 2023-03-18 04:29:28 +0100
  • 30034847a2 qml: remove Never as request expiry option Sander van Grieken 2023-03-18 00:57:39 +0100
  • 39ac484ec7 qml: password change requires password, not PIN. fixes #8257 Sander van Grieken 2023-03-18 00:52:42 +0100
  • fed5fe5991 Qml: new receive flow. fixes #8258 ThomasV 2023-03-17 23:02:43 +0100
  • adca13a86c
    android readme: update "access datadir on Android from desktop" SomberNight 2023-03-17 19:21:01 +0000
  • 48e37696b3
    qml wizard: fix creating wallet from master key SomberNight 2023-03-17 18:31:50 +0000
  • a90bff4586
    qml: mark masterkey/wif/addr input fields as sensitive SomberNight 2023-03-17 17:09:01 +0000
  • 231ea5d03b qml: status icon InvoiceDialog Sander van Grieken 2023-03-17 17:32:27 +0100
  • 55da7276d3
    qt export history/privkeys: put wallet name in path SomberNight 2023-03-17 15:49:58 +0000
  • 8db1c3814b
    qt export history: let util.filename_field decide default path SomberNight 2023-03-17 15:47:42 +0000
  • 7d2ba3cc39 qml: fix 43d6fd2aef Sander van Grieken 2023-03-17 16:46:35 +0100
  • 24a3d6e10f qml: remove editmode toggle, now enabled only on amount-less invoices Sander van Grieken 2023-03-17 16:44:26 +0100
  • c3a0f9c078 Qt swaps_dialog: do not use side effects to update tx. ThomasV 2023-03-16 20:11:25 +0100
  • 8eca3e0aaf follow up 7c2f13a76e Sander van Grieken 2023-03-17 12:33:53 +0100
  • 7c2f13a76e follow-up fcbd25c1fd. fixes #8253 ThomasV 2023-03-17 12:30:58 +0100
  • 0b3279820a rm log Sander van Grieken 2023-03-17 12:01:55 +0100
  • 8528907a5b qml: trsutedcoin layout consistency Sander van Grieken 2023-03-17 11:51:10 +0100
  • a571451179 qml: allow pay while amount in edit mode Sander van Grieken 2023-03-17 11:50:41 +0100
  • fcbd25c1fd qml: display network status and history server status separately. Also, show network fees on full screen width ThomasV 2023-03-17 10:15:07 +0100
  • 49683d6ff1 qml: do not set oneserver based on auto_connect. ThomasV 2023-03-17 09:22:35 +0100
  • 0bb41a32c8 qml: fix layout issues in ShowConfirmOTP. fixes #8249 Sander van Grieken 2023-03-17 00:23:50 +0100
  • 3e5c692660 qml: don't log (potentially) sensitive data, closes #8124 Sander van Grieken 2023-03-17 00:13:16 +0100
  • 3574c99275 qml: in the password dialogs, disable the password confirmation line if the first entered password is too short. ThomasV 2023-03-16 20:51:10 +0100
  • ff2da7ceb9
    crash reporter: hardcode gui text. do not trust the server with it SomberNight 2023-03-16 19:07:33 +0000
  • 849d987d0d qml: fix #8247 ThomasV 2023-03-16 20:23:29 +0100
  • 57a4cbb984 follow-up 7a86d8d: ask proxy first ThomasV 2023-03-16 20:07:58 +0100
  • 6890268b1d qml: fix display of server fee in swap dialog ThomasV 2023-03-16 19:29:56 +0100
  • d4d6d05d9f
    qml wizard: enable restore from "2fa" legacy seeds SomberNight 2023-03-16 17:40:30 +0000
  • 13a9d1e2fb Add info on how to scan channel backups ThomasV 2023-03-16 17:24:07 +0100
  • 2ef60b906f Reword proxy question. ThomasV 2023-03-16 17:09:16 +0100
  • 0a5d18634c
    exchange_rate: guard against garbage hist data coming from exchange SomberNight 2023-03-16 16:11:02 +0000
  • 7207f13e97 Qt: set history_rates both through settings_dialog and history_list ThomasV 2023-03-16 16:48:12 +0100
  • 3a7bc82881
    icons: add "cloud_yes.png", and rename existing "nocloud" SomberNight 2023-03-16 15:22:10 +0000
  • 7a86d8dc9e qml: ask user whether to configure Tor or other proxy before presenting proxy detail config screen Sander van Grieken 2023-03-16 15:42:24 +0100
  • 39eaf9d871 qml: sharing channel backup only shows QR, not the data as text Sander van Grieken 2023-03-16 15:12:51 +0100
  • d985c9eecc qml: use InfoTextArea for help text in GenericShareDialog Sander van Grieken 2023-03-16 15:10:42 +0100
  • 67cb08a835 qml: slider render voids Sander van Grieken 2023-03-16 15:03:05 +0100
  • f49ef14de8 qml: SwapDialog slider styling; add zero tick and fill slider range from zero Sander van Grieken 2023-03-16 14:14:46 +0100
  • e2867b7fe8 qml: move Pay button to the right ThomasV 2023-03-16 13:02:49 +0100